Skocz do zawartości
  • 👋 Witaj na MPCForum!

    Przeglądasz forum jako gość, co oznacza, że wiele świetnych funkcji jest jeszcze przed Tobą! 😎

    • Pełny dostęp do działów i ukrytych treści
    • Możliwość pisania i odpowiadania w tematach
    • System prywatnych wiadomości
    • Zbieranie reputacji i rozwijanie swojego profilu
    • Członkostwo w jednej z największych społeczności graczy

    👉 Dołączenie zajmie Ci mniej niż minutę – a zyskasz znacznie więcej!

    Zarejestruj się teraz

[Problem] Logowanie działa, na postać nie działa...


dram

Rekomendowane odpowiedzi

Opublikowano

Hello.. system 64 bity, pliki sharera game2089

 

Tak jak w temacie

 

moja infrastruktura sieci wygląda tak

 

internet -> router dostawcy -> router mój -> pc #1 +pc#2

 

DMZ na pc#2

 

Ja mogę łączyć się do pc#2 ale co dziwne jak łącze się przez ip dostawcy to od razu zmienia serwer na ip takie jakie mi router przydziela

 

LOG Z /DB/ poprawnego zalogowania (przec PC#1 do pc #2)

 

Oct 18 22:14:48 :: AUTH_LOGIN id(1) login(test5) social_id(0000000) login_key(172493777), client_key(1965049581 437300654 1023051744 1676583526)
Oct 18 22:14:48 :: [	 550] return 0/0/0 async 0/0/0
Oct 18 22:14:51 :: LOGIN_BY_KEY success test5 172493777 192.168.10.142
Oct 18 22:14:51 :: RESULT_LOGIN: login success test5 rows: 1
Oct 18 22:14:51 :: konto 460584 953216 hair 0
Oct 18 22:14:53 :: [	 600] return 0/0/0 async 0/0/0
Oct 18 22:14:58 :: LOGIN_BY_KEY success test5 172493777 192.168.1.100
Oct 18 22:14:58 :: RESULT_LOGIN: login success test5 rows: 1
Oct 18 22:14:58 :: konto 460584 953216 hair 0
Oct 18 22:14:58 :: [	 650] return 0/0/2 async 0/0/0
Oct 18 22:14:59 :: [PLAYER_LOAD] Load from PlayerDB pid[1]
Oct 18 22:14:59 :: QID_PLAYER 4 1
Oct 18 22:14:59 :: SetPlay on 172493777 test5
Oct 18 22:14:59 :: QID_ITEM 4
Oct 18 22:14:59 :: ITEM_LOAD: count 7 pid 1
Oct 18 22:14:59 :: QID_QUEST 4
Oct 18 22:14:59 :: QUEST_LOAD: count 4 PID 1
Oct 18 22:14:59 :: QID_AFFECT 4

Zauważcie że serwer automatycznie z ip (które daje mi dostawca) zmienia w ip które przypisuje mój ruter do mojego kompa (pc #1)

 

 

Teraz ktoś próbuje połączyć się przez publiczne ip z pc#2 = metinem.

 

Oct 18 22:11:15 :: AUTH_LOGIN id(1) login(test5) social_id(0000000) login_key(1806081185), client_key(1286274032 1837265122 247545241 817041248)
Oct 18 22:11:16 :: LOGIN_BY_KEY success test5 1806081185 217.173.190.112
Oct 18 22:11:16 :: RESULT_LOGIN: login success test5 rows: 1
Oct 18 22:11:16 :: konto 460584 953216 hair 0
Oct 18 22:11:18 :: [	 1500] return 0/0/0 async 0/0/0
Oct 18 22:11:23 :: [	 1550] return 0/0/0 async 0/0/0
Oct 18 22:11:28 :: [	 1600] return 0/0/0 async 0/0/0
Oct 18 22:11:33 :: [	 1650] return 0/0/0 async 0/0/0
Oct 18 22:11:38 :: [	 1700] return 0/0/0 async 0/0/0
Oct 18 22:11:43 :: [	 1750] return 0/0/0 async 0/0/0
Oct 18 22:11:48 :: [	 1800] return 0/0/0 async 0/0/0
Oct 18 22:11:53 :: [	 1850] return 0/0/0 async 0/0/0
Oct 18 22:11:58 :: [	 1900] return 0/0/0 async 0/0/0
Oct 18 22:12:03 :: [	 1950] return 0/0/0 async 0/0/0
Oct 18 22:12:08 :: [	 2000] return 0/0/0 async 0/0/0
Oct 18 22:12:13 :: [	 2050] return 0/0/0 async 0/0/0
Oct 18 22:12:18 :: [	 2100] return 0/0/0 async 0/0/0
Oct 18 22:12:23 :: [	 2150] return 0/0/0 async 0/0/0
Oct 18 22:12:28 :: [	 2200] return 0/0/0 async 0/0/0

 

Logowanie przebiega tak ,że loguje się(przez publiczne ip) na konto widzi postacie, ale po wybraniu postaci wywala do menu serwerów.

 

Tak jakby był jakiś problem przekazywania ip z auth do game

 

Przy ładowaniu serwera wywala PUBLIC_IP: 192.168.1.102 ,a to publcizne ip moje nie jest (to ip jest przypisywane przez mój ruter do pc #2)

 

Cos moze z ustawieniem sieci? Może publiczne ip jakos przypisać menualnie?

 

Proszę o pomoc ,jestem w stanie dać dostęp do ssh.

 

-- Jeżeli mi ktoś pomoże to stawiam wagon lajków, wagon piwa ciężarówką pod sam dom...

Kocham mpcforum.pl!!!

18706.png

Opublikowano

zle porty albo game padł daj syserr z plików gdzie w configu jest mapa o indexie 1 21 i 41

Wiem kto jest swój, a kto zwykły pedał
Intel Xeon E5 1650 v2 16GB Ram 1 TB SSD 2x D500 3GB

 

Opublikowano

To jest /game/

 

Tu jest CONFIG

 

HOSTNAME: channel1
CHANNEL: 1
PORT: 13000
P2P_PORT: 14000
DB_PORT: 15000
DB_ADDR: localhost
MAP_ALLOW: 1 2 3 4 5 6 7 8 9 10 11 21 23 24 25 41 43 44 45 61 62 63 64 65 66 69 70 71 72 73 104 108 109 67 68 80 74 75 76 77 78 79 100 101 103 105 107 180 190 191 192 193 194 110 111
TABLE_POSTFIX:
PASSES_PER_SEC: 25
SAVE_EVENT_SECOND_CYCLE: 180
PING_EVENT_SECOND_CYCLE: 180
PLAYER_SQL: localhost mt2 mt2!@# player
LOG_SQL: localhost mt2 mt2!@# log
COMMON_SQL: localhost mt2 mt2!@# common
LOCALE_SERVICE: poland
#TEST_SERVER: 1
#NO_PK: 1
MALL_URL: mpcforum.pl
adminpage_ip0: localhost
admin_page_password: gfkartji234j243ifjas
VIEW_RANGE: 20000
CHECK_MULTIHACK: 1
adminpage_ip1: localhost
adminpage_ip2: localhost
adminpage_ip3: localhost

 

A tu syserr i syslog od czasu postawienia serwera do (pomyślnego zalogowania przeze mnie z pc #1 ) i wpisania ./close.sh czyli wyłączenia

 

syserr

http://wklej.to/WW6gj

 

syslog

http://wklej.to/WEbHx

Kocham mpcforum.pl!!!

18706.png

Opublikowano

GetServerLocation: location error name mapindex 0 0 x 0 empire 1

 

 

warpy :P i postać się buguje

Wiem kto jest swój, a kto zwykły pedał
Intel Xeon E5 1650 v2 16GB Ram 1 TB SSD 2x D500 3GB

 

Opublikowano

aha

 

To może źle zrozumiałem sprawdz w takim razie port z ch1 czy jest online na kompie na którym nie możesz się zalogować

jeśli ziała na #1 to na #2 tez powinno jesli wywala to Zablokowany port albo złe Server info

Wiem kto jest swój, a kto zwykły pedał
Intel Xeon E5 1650 v2 16GB Ram 1 TB SSD 2x D500 3GB

 

Opublikowano

no tak serwer ma status "NORMALNY" po wpisaniu danych jest menu postaci, po wybraniu postaci wywala do menu serwerów.

 

Na kompie na którym działa wszystko ok, jest tak samo z tym ,że zamiast wywalać do menu serwerów normalnie prawidłowo loguje się na serwer.

Kocham mpcforum.pl!!!

18706.png

Opublikowano

To coś albo z serverinfo albo z Portem jak tam działa to powinno tez działać tu nie ma innego wyjścia a Normal moze pisać bo masz odblokowane UDP a TCP Offline

 

 

Sprawdz czy ruter ma odblokowane porty i jak coś to łaczysz się z IP z ipconfig z kompa gdzie masz serwer zew-ip jest dla graczy z poza rutera

 

 

czyli np Ip Komp #1 192.168.1.1

Komp #2 192.168.1.2

 

to komp #2 musi mieć serwer info z 192.168.1.1 w serverinfo i sprawdz czy ruter puszcza TCP

Wiem kto jest swój, a kto zwykły pedał
Intel Xeon E5 1650 v2 16GB Ram 1 TB SSD 2x D500 3GB

 

Opublikowano

Tak jest DMZ na ip 192.168.1.102 oraz porty również na to ip są odblokowane (to jest #pc 2 czyli host)

 

w ifconfig nie ma zadnej wzmianki o ip publicznym lub które przydziela mojemu ruterowi mój dostawca internetu.

 

Jak to czy ruter puszcza TCP?

 

--

Bardziej wydaje mi się że to wina jest konfiguracji serwera tylko za cholere nie wiem co możę być nie tak.

Bo tak na prawdę taki osobnik który sie łączy przez publiczne ip widzi postacie (więc tak na prawde jakies połączenie bodajże z AUTH) jest.

Problem w tym ,że nie może się zalogować na konkretną postać bo wtedy wyrzuca do ekranu listy serwerów.

 

Jak już pisałem dla ludzi którzy na prawdę chcą mi pomóc i wiedza jak jestem w stanie dać dostęp ssh.

Kocham mpcforum.pl!!!

18706.png

Opublikowano

Hmm tylko u mnie systuacja jest inna, tzn. ja mam serwer na osobnym kompie a ty prezentujesz to tak jakbym miał na tym samym na virtual boxie.

 

I tak na prawdę nie wiem co gdzie ustawić i jak może w gateway ip mojego rutera a w ipv4 adress ip jakie moj ruter przypisuje pc #2

 

 

Ale tak też nie chce śmigać, mnie łączy kumpla nie.

Kocham mpcforum.pl!!!

18706.png

Opublikowano

no dobra ale serwer jak masz ruter to i tak w sieci lokalnej jest 192.xxx.xx.xxx a jak kumpel nie chcę połaczyć to może nie masz zew-IP

Wiem kto jest swój, a kto zwykły pedał
Intel Xeon E5 1650 v2 16GB Ram 1 TB SSD 2x D500 3GB

 

Opublikowano

A dokładniej? Próbowałem launcherem który zawsze mi działał czyli taki żółty 4 mb, próbowałem też launcherem 2011 pod hamachi i też nie działa.

 

 

A obydwoje używamy takiego samego klienta tylko z innym rootem więc co moze być nie tak?

Kocham mpcforum.pl!!!

18706.png

Opublikowano

Tak korzystając z publicznego ip.

 

Widzi postacie ale wywala go po wybraniu konkretnej postaci do listy serwerów

 

Jak ja korzystam z ip które mój ruter przypisuje hostowi (Czyli kompowi drugiemu tam gdzie stoi metin) u mnie wszystko poprawnie działa.

 

A syserr klientowe w obu przypadkach jest puste

Kocham mpcforum.pl!!!

18706.png

Opublikowano

~refresh~

 

Jeszcze ew takie błędy się w db pojawiły:

 

Oct 23 22:12:14 :: SETUP: channel 1 listen 13000 p2p 14000 count 1
Oct 23 22:12:14 :: SETUP: login 55 login_key 0 host
Oct 23 22:12:14 :: SetPlay on 0
Oct 23 22:12:14 :: SETUP: login_fail 0 login_key 0
Oct 23 22:12:14 :: SETUP: login_fail 0 login_key 0
Oct 23 22:12:14 :: SETUP: login_fail 0 login_key 0
Oct 23 22:12:14 :: SETUP: login_fail 0 login_key 0
Oct 23 22:12:14 :: SETUP: login_fail 0 login_key 0

 

A jeszcze na innym game był closing socket. DESC #16 / #17 lub #18

Kocham mpcforum.pl!!!

18706.png

Zarchiwizowany

Ten temat przebywa obecnie w archiwum. Dodawanie nowych odpowiedzi zostało zablokowane.

×
×
  • Dodaj nową pozycję...